JUST IN: PLATEAU 2023 GOVERNORSHIP RACE: KANKE PDP CAUCUS MANY SUBMIT POSITION FOR ADOPTION BY STATE, ON OR BEFORE, 9TH APRIL

By: Valentine Adese (JP) and Label Daniel Musuka,

There are strong indications that, the Peoples’ Democratic Party (PDP) Caucus in Kanke Local Government Area (LGA) and within the Panshin, Kanke and Kanam (PKK) Federal Constituency of Plateau State may join the Ngas group to submitting its position on the forthcoming 2023 Governorship race in the state.

REALITY gathered that, though there is a sealed lip over the resolution of the Caucus during its meeting in Jos, the capital of Plateau State recently, the news that the body may tender its position to the State Executive Council on or before the 9th of April, 2022, is causing worries and anxiety among Aspirants that may have picked forms to contest in the forthcoming, 2023 general election especially, for the Governorship seat.

You would recall that the PDP had extended the dead line for Aspirants to pick form to the 8th of April, 2022 to enable more Aspirants have the opportunity of doing so.

However, at the time of filing this report, only Dr. Timothy Golu is reported to have purchased and presented his forms to the Ngas Nation in PKK.

In another development, Pam Jang, the eldest son of the former governor of Plateau State, Sen. Jonah Jang, has picked his form to contest for the Jos-South/Jos-East House of Representatives seat, alongside, the Speaker of Plateau State House of Assembly, Rt. Hon. Ayuba Abok, and Musa Ashoms.
